Description:

HARDCOVER EDITION. A young orphan is adopted and raised by great apes in Africa. He grows to manhood as Tarzan, King of the Apes. He soon falls in love with the beautiful Jane Porter. Filled with many exciting adventures, this book follows the original, uncensored text of the pulp magazine All Story.
